So i have an acer aspire 3000 with the stock 256mb ram and im looking to upgrade it to 1gb
my problem is that the manual gives the maximum memory module size as 512mb in ech of the two slots while two ram choosers on the kingston and corsair websites have told me that i can use 1gb modules
I would like to know if i can actually use 1gb modules as it is simpler and i can upgrade again in the future (and if this is possible can i out both the old 256mb module and new 1gb modules in together to give 1280 mb)
thanks
 
That should work , using the 1gb and 256 sticks, but it might not run at the full ddr333 mhz speed. the reason it might not be posted like that on acer's website is because they "do not recommend it" for the reason i stated before.
